When we attended our daughter's graduation from ASU in May of 2008 we spent the day in the ASU stadium parking lot, which is walking distance to the graduation facility, and then dry camped the night at the nearby Walmart. There is a nice Cracker Barrel restaurant in the same parking lot. The reason we chose to dry camp was that the first two RV parks we contacted had a 10 year old limitation on motorhomes, and at 1982 we are considerably past that age restriction. We sent them a picture of our coach, but it made no difference. They were not concerned with the condition of the coach, just the age.
